Ok your battery, how many ground wires do you have? If the gsx is like the XP you should have 2.
 
Yes, the GSX is the XP with a second seat
The photo is where i pulled the black and white spades off the coil to isolate the coil and test for resistance. Per Seadoo Manual

I asked how many wires are on the battery ground. If you're missing the little one it will crank all day with no spark.
